A new report, "India Justice Report 2025", highlights the stark gender disparity in India's police force, with less than 1,000 women holding senior positions like Director-Generals and Superintendents of Police. Despite growing awareness about the need for gender diversity in law enforcement, not a single state or Union Territory has met its target for women's representation in the police force. The report also emphasizes the significant challenges faced by the justice system as a whole, including infrastructural deficiencies, overcrowding in prisons, and inadequate staffing levels. The report calls for systemic reforms to address these issues and ensure a more equitable and accessible justice system for all.

Telangana Director General of Police Jitender has instructed officials to implement foolproof security measures for the upcoming Miss World pageant, which is being hosted by the state government. The 72nd edition of the Miss World pageant is set to take place in Telangana this month, with both the opening and closing ceremonies, including the grand finale scheduled to be held in Hyderabad. The DGP reviewed security preparations with senior police officials and emphasized the need for comprehensive security measures given the global exposure the event provides for Telangana. Contestants from about 120 countries are expected to participate, with confirmations already received from 116 nations. The contestants will tour various regions of the state in groups over the span of a month, visiting prominent tourist and heritage sites. A centralized control system will be set up to coordinate security at these locations and events. The Telangana police will ensure robust security for the participating contestants and guests, showcasing their efficiency to the world.

Four recent encounters in Jammu and Kashmir's Kathua district have exposed the route used by terrorists to infiltrate into India from across the International Border (IB), a senior police officer said. The successful recovery of huge quantities of arms and ammunition, including explosives, after the gunfights has scuttled a major plan of the terror groups to carry out a major strike in Jammu and Kashmir.
